The pooled analysis of primary outcomes showed that VR improves test scores moderately compared with other approaches (standardized mean difference [SMD] = 0.53; 95% Confidence Interval [CI] 0.09–0.97, p < 0.05; I2 = 87.8%). The high homogeneity indicated that the studies were different from each other. Therefore, we carried out meta-regression as well as subgroup analyses using seven variables (year, country, learners, course, intervention, comparator, and duration). We found that VR improves post-intervention test scores of anatomy compared with other types of teaching methods.”

“The effectiveness of virtual reality-based technology on anatomy teaching: a meta-analysis of randomized controlled studies.” — by Jingjie Zhao, Xinliang Xu, Hualin Jiang, and Yi Ding
